A wide range of models for every need

Trejon provides a broad selection of buckets, including both disc spreaders and drop spreaders, designed to meet varying demands for ice control. The disc spreaders are ideal for tasks that require wide and precise spreading over large areas, while the drop spreaders are perfect for more specific spreading needs and small to medium-sized surfaces.

Disc spreaders

The Trejon Optimal disc spreader is a flexible and efficient bucket designed for tasks that require adjustable spreading widths. These spreaders are ideal for parking lots, roads, and industrial areas. Equipped with an agitator, feeder screw, and a disc, they evenly distribute sand, salt, and gravel over an area of up to ten meters.

With the Control Plus electric control system, you have full control over spreading width and quantity conveniently from the cabin. The settings can be adjusted in grams per square meter, and with a speed sensor, the system automatically increases or decreases the amount based on the current driving speed. This is standard on the DS2500 model but is also available as an option for other models.

Drop spreaders

Trejon Optimal drop spreaders are designed to withstand the most demanding winter conditions throughout Scandinavia. These spreaders combine easy-to-use design with precision and safety when spreading sand (2-8 mm), stone chips (2-8 mm) and salt.

The SP250-SP2700 models are controlled by the hydraulics of the tool carrier and offer stepless adjustment of the spreading quantity. The rubber blanket pressure can be easily adjusted via a handle on the side of the spreader. For further efficiency, 3-point models can be equipped with an optional hydraulic self-loading function, eliminating the need for an additional tractor and saving time and money.
